logo

Output 50ba61d731f3d7588472731866446d47d1b60f9c2437bc7e5745332891a1b2f8:64

value
24227859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d1d0cbd51c9b0e4e05d976ba9c7fc8821c309b OP_EQUAL
address
3AF67dPNQRaiUCP7TgXYT6mP3NNQP7GM1o
transaction
50ba61d731f3d7588472731866446d47d1b60f9c2437bc7e5745332891a1b2f8